Review by College President |
Within seven (7) days after requesting review, the party
seeking review shall submit to the President a written statement setting
forth, the reasons why that party believes the decision of the Hearing
Board is incorrect. The other party shall have seven (7) days to
respond in writing to that statement. Review of the decision
of the Hearing Board shall then be conducted in such manner as the
President shall determine and may or may not include the right to present
oral argument to the President. The President may affirm, reverse,
or modify the decision of the Hearing Board or the sanction assessed,
provided that the President shall not increase the sanctions beyond that
which was recommended by the Director for Student Life in the
first instance. The President may also remand the case to the
Hearing Board for further hearing upon such issues as the President may
designate. The President's decision shall be in writing and shall be
served on the interested parties. The decision shall be
accompanied by a notice stating that, if any party is dissatisfied with
the President's decision and wishes to appeal it to the State Board of
Education, a notice of intent to appeal must be delivered to the office of
the President within seven (7) days of service of the decision and notice.
The failure of a party to give timely notice of the intent to appeal to
the State Board of Education shall be a waiver of that right and the
decision of the President shall become final. |

Appeal to State Board of Education |
A party's final right to appeal is to the State Board of
Education, provided that the State Board of Education shall determine
when, whether, and in what manner it will hear such appeal.

| General |
Any notice, report, decision or request which is to be
given or served under this proceedings will be deemed given or served when
either personally delivered to the person or office entitled to the notice
or when deposited in the United States Mail, certified mail, postage
prepaid, addressed to the person or office at that person's last-known
address as shown on the records of the College.
